Local Look

USA Luge's all-time international medal winner, Mark Grimmette of Muskegon, was introduced to luge in the mid-1980s when a luge run was constructed at Muskegon State Park, across the street from his family's house. The top of the track is now named Grimmette Peak. A 1989 graduate of Reeths-Puffer High School in Muskegon, Grimmette played offensive end for the Rockets football team all four years.  After graduating high school, he attended Muskegon Community College. When he's not training, Grimmette likes reading, hiking and woodworking. He makes furniture for himself, and hopes one day to be good enough to sell his work.
